**Step 9 — Tide-Table Widget.** Verify the Saltmere tide-table widget renders predictions from the ceremony staging feed, not production. Plugin authors must confirm their data adapter passed the checksum review before key sealing proceeds. Once confirmed, open the widget's signing store using the recovery passphrase that follows.

unlock words, kagef-taduf: fenir-quenix-norwyn-sorvan-gormir-gorir-fraok

Finance: the Calder Creek Roastery franchise agreement with operator Brightway Holdings was executed last week. Terms: 7-year initial period, 6% royalty on gross sales, 2% marketing levy, quarterly remittance. Territory covers the Pellworth district only. Capex for fit-out sits with the franchisee; we fund signage up to an agreed cap. Book royalties under the standard franchise revenue line. Audit rights run annually. Review the projection model before month-end close. The note below outlines our expansion intentions for this operator.

board note of kageg-bahof: The renewal with Holwynax Holdings closes at $2 million a year, 5 percent below the last contract. Project Ulaath slips by two quarters because of the supplier delay.

## v1.9.2 — Watchdog setting renamed

`TOTEMKIOSK_WD_SECRET` is now `TK_WATCHDOG_AUTH`. Old name is ignored as of this release — no fallback. If kiosks boot-loop after upgrade, this is why. Update the env file on each unit before pushing the image. Restart interval and ping settings are unchanged. Nothing else in this release touches the watchdog. Your provisioning template needs exactly one edit: in the kiosk `.env`, the renamed entry goes on the following line:

sealed setting: RELAY_SECRET5=82864